Transaction

2e9cb80d2f51e85776d9b851d52fb02ccbb7643f82aa78e316a77ee73a8e8dce
390,898 confirmations
Timestamp
1540708410
Block547,645
Fee693 sats
Fee rate4.17 sats/vB
view on mempool.space

Inputs & Outputs